Storm Amy: Power Restoration in Cumbria

Storm Amy caused widespread disruption in Cumbria, including flood warnings, event cancellations, and power outages, due to heavy rainfall and winds of up to 80 miles per hour from October 3 to October 5.

The storm damaged powerlines, resulting in power outages for homes and businesses across Cumbria, prompting a strategic response from SP Electricity North West.

An estimated 1,500 homes were still without power on Saturday morning, but thanks to tech innovation, the firm was able to restore power to "thousands of households within minutes."

A fallen tree collapsed onto a powerline in Cartmel during Storm Amy, contributing to the power outages.
